## Shared Lab Access — West Annex

The Meridian Optics lab on Level 2 is shared with the Calyx Instruments team. Facilities staff should confirm that visitors from either team sign the shared-use log before entry, and that the fume hood schedule is checked on the wall chart. Out-of-hours access must be cleared with the duty supervisor. The current door-pass code for the annex entrance is listed below.

staff pass of kawip-hawef = bdg-QLP-2

Welcome to the Marlet Systems docs team. Prosewright checks every markdown file for style violations, broken anchors, and stale glossary terms before merge. Install dependencies with `make deps`, then run `prosewright init` to generate your local config. The linter caches rule results and term definitions in a small Postgres instance so repeated runs stay fast; start it with `make db-up` before your first lint. Once the container reports healthy, configure the linter to reach it with the connection string below.

replica DSN, kajep-yahag: mssql://praok_svc:iF@db-8d68.plorvaio.local:5432/eliion

Subject: Tidybranch cleanup bot — new behavior in tonight's release

Team, starting tonight the Tidybranch bot archives branches idle for 90 days instead of deleting them outright. Archived branches are recoverable for 30 days via the restore command, so please point customers there before filing escalations. The bot also now posts a summary to the repo activity log after each sweep. When verifying a customer's sweep, match it against the identifier below.

session token of yahof-bajeg = htk9_0d43d44ed

Enviroments for Syncspindle, our calendar sync service, differ in how they resolve conflicting edits. Staging at the Harwick cluster uses last-writer-wins; production applies a three-way merge against the canonical feed. During a conflict storm, check that the resolver pool hasn't fallen back to staging behaviour — this happened twice last quarter and produced duplicate events for the Brindlemoor tenant. Before paging the sync team, confirm the production resolver is running with the configuration shown below.

settings of fafog-haduf:
ZORIX_PIN=4648
ZORIX_METRICS_HOST=metrics.zorix.paliqsys.corp
ZORIX_LOG_LEVEL=info
ZORIX_TENANT=druix